31426001 has 2 divisors, whose sum is σ = 31426002. Its totient is φ = 31426000.

The previous prime is 31425941. The next prime is 31426009. The reversal of 31426001 is 10062413.

It is a strong prime.

It can be written as a sum of positive squares in only one way, i.e., 30747025 + 678976 = 5545^2 + 824^2 .

It is an emirp because it is prime and its reverse (10062413) is a distict prime.

It is a cyclic number.

It is not a de Polignac number, because 31426001 - 210 = 31424977 is a prime.

It is not a weakly prime, because it can be changed into another prime (31426009) by changing a digit.

It is a polite number, since it can be written as a sum of consecutive naturals, namely, 15713000 + 15713001.

It is an arithmetic number, because the mean of its divisors is an integer number (15713001).

Almost surely, 231426001 is an apocalyptic number.

It is an amenable number.

31426001 is a deficient number, since it is larger than the sum of its proper divisors (1).

31426001 is an equidigital number, since it uses as much as digits as its factorization.

31426001 is an odious number, because the sum of its binary digits is odd.

The product of its (nonzero) digits is 144, while the sum is 17.

The square root of 31426001 is about 5605.8898490784. The cubic root of 31426001 is about 315.5704821172.

Adding to 31426001 its reverse (10062413), we get a palindrome (41488414).
